Abstract

PURPOSE:To easily realize the switching operation utilizing a large resistivity of an oxide and resistance zero condition of superconductivity using a simplified structure by providing a first electric line of superconductor and a second electric line of oxide superconductor and then providing the first and second electric lines in close protimity to each other through an insulator. CONSTITUTION:A Y-Ba-Cu-O superconductor electric line 1 is formed as a first electric line on an SiO2 substrate 4 of a superconducting device and a Y-Ba-Cu-O superconductor electric line in the same way. These first and second electric lines are electrically connected by a SiO2 thin film 3. If no current flows into this electric line 1, the electric line 2 becomes superconducting with resistance 0. When a current flows into the electric line 1 from such condition, an electric field is induced on the electric line 2 due to the electric field generated around the electric line 1 and the superconducting condition changes to the normal conductive condition. Thickness of the second electric line 2 is set to 0.1mum or less.
